工作职责
The Event Marketing Operations Intern will support the US Events Team across both backend operations and on-site execution. This role is primarily focused on internal processes, coordination with global HQ, and operational support including inventory management and event production. The ideal candidate is highly organized, detail-oriented, and comfortable working in a fast-paced, cross-functional environment. Key Responsibilities Event Operations & Backend Support Assist with internal event workflows, including approvals, documentation, and SOP development Support event production processes such as vendor coordination, asset tracking, and logistics planning Help manage product inventory, including tracking, allocation, and write-offs across events Maintain organized records of event materials, shipments, and inventory movement Global Coordination Communicate and coordinate with cross-functional teams at our China HQ Support HQ governance processes, including documentation, approvals, and reporting Project Management & Execution Track timelines, budgets, and deliverables across multiple events simultaneously Assist in pre-event planning and support occasional on-site execution Support post-event reporting, including inventory reconciliation and operational summaries
